Are people in Kaysville older or younger than people in Ellington?
- The Median Age in Kaysville is 8.1 years younger than in Ellington.

Are housing costs cheaper in Kaysville or Ellington?
- Kaysville housing costs are 69.2% more expensive than Ellington hous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Kaysville or Ellington?
- The average commute for residents of Kaysville is 3.8 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Ellington.

Things to do in Ellington?
Ellington is a small rural town located northeast from Hartford filled with lush forests and fields featuring several public parks ideal for taking long walks plus plenty of nearby lakeside activities such as kayaking and biking throughout Noden Reed Park & Reserve making it an ideal destination for weekend getaways.

Things to do in Kaysville?
Kaysville UT rests north Salt Lake City boasting tons of entertainment options that range from live music venues perfect for those who want a unique nightlife experience plus offering easy access nearby ski resorts during winter season.
